MOS:Master Note for Real Application Clusters (RAC) Oracle Clusterware and Oracle Grid Infrastructur

Master Note for Real Application Clusters (RAC) Oracle Clusterware and Oracle Grid Infrastructure

RAC Best Practice and Starter Kit Information

The goal of the Oracle Real Application Clusters (RAC) series of Best Practice and Starter Kit notes is to provide the latest information on generic and platform specific best practices for implementing an Oracle cluster using Oracle Clusterware or Oracle Grid Infrastructure (11gR2) and Oracle Real Application Clusters. These documents are compiled and maintained based on Oracle Support's ongoing experience with its global RAC customer base. The process used to install, configure, and create an Oracle Cluster and an Oracle Real Application Clusters (RAC) database shares much in common across all supported operating system platforms. Despite these commonalities, many aspects of the deployment process are O/S specific. As such, there is a Generic Starter Kit, as well as a separate Starter Kit for each supported platform. These Starter Kits provide the latest information in terms of installation help, as well as best practices for ongoing/existing implementations.

The Generic Starter Kit has attached documents with sample test plan outlines for system testing and basic load-testing to validate the infrastructure is setup correctly, as well as a sample project plan outline for your RAC implementation. In addition, best practices for Storage and networking and other areas are included. The Platform-specific Starter Kit notes complement this with Step-by-Step Installation Guides, for each particular platform, as well as best practices for the specific platform in question.

RACcheck - RAC Configuration Audit Tool

RACcheck is a RAC Configuration Audit tool designed to audit various important configuration settings within Real Application Clusters (RAC), Oracle Clusterware (CRS), Automatic Storage Management (ASM) and Grid Infrastructure environments. This utility is to be used to validate the Best Pracices and Success Factors defined in the series of Oracle Real Application Clusters (RAC) Best Practice and Starter Kit notes which are maintained by the RAC Assurance development and support teams. At present RACcheck supports Linux (x86 and x86_64), Solais (SPARC and x86_64), HP-UX (Itanium and PA-RISC with the bash shell) and AIX (with the bash shell) platforms. Those customers running RAC on the RACcheck supported platorms are strongly encouraged to utilize this tool identify potential configuration issues that could impact the stability of the cluster.

Note:  Oracle is constantly generating and maintaining Best Practices and Success Factors from the global customer base.  As a result the RACcheck utility is frequently updated with this information.  That said, it is recommended that you ensure you are using the version of RACcheck prior to execution.


Additional Notes on RAC and Clusterware Installation and Frequently asked Questions


While the Starter Kits referenced above will contain much of what you need to get started, additional notes and resources that are important to take heed of, particularly for a new implementation, can be found here in the following FAQ’s and other references:

Key notes related to OS Installation requirements for a RAC or Oracle Clusterware environment

  • Document 359515.1 Mount Options for Oracle files when used with NAS devices
  • Document 401132.1 How to install Oracle Clusterware with shared storage on block devices 
  • Document 357472.1 Configuring device-mapper for CRS/ASM 
  • Document 169706.1 Oracle Database on AIX,HP-UX,Linux,MacOSX,Solaris,Tru64 Operating Systems Installation and Configuration Requirements Quick Reference (8.0.5 to 11.1) 

Key notes introducing differences in Oracle 11gR2

RAC and Clusterware Monitoring, Troubleshooting and Data Collection Notes


To effectively manage your RAC cluster, it is important to know how to monitor, troubleshoot and collect data, both for your own diagnosis, and also to provide supporting information when logging a service request. The following Notes will give you information on how to do both: 


Tools for Monitoring RAC and Clusterware Environments

 

References needed for Troubleshooting and Data Collection

 

RAC and Clusterware Testing and Performance Tuning

Much of RAC performance tuning is no different from single instance database€ tuning. However, there are some additional areas to check in a RAC environment when tuning or troubleshooting performance related issues. The following notes will make you aware of some of the areas where performance tuning and diagnosis has a specific RAC flavor:

 

RAC and Clusterware Certification, Maintenance, and Patching References

Maintenance of a RAC environment is similar in many respects to maintaining a single-instance environment. However, with the Clusterware and Grid Infrastructure stacks, there are some additional tasks to be aware of regarding ongoing maintenance, as well as maintenance that may be brought on by changes to your environment. Below are some references speaking to the areas of general maintenance that may be needed or affect RAC environments in a particular way, as well as references to patching, which is a key part of an ongoing maintenance strategy.

Certification References for RAC and Clusterware Environments


General Maintenance References for RAC and Clusterware Environments


Patching Best Practices and References for RAC and Oracle Clusterware 
As part of an overall maintenance strategy, it is critical that customers have a formal strategy to stay in front of known issues and bugs. To make it easier for customers to obtain and deploy fixes for known critical issues please refer to the following list of references.

 

Upgrade and Platform Migration for RAC and Oracle Clusterware


When migrating a RAC cluster to a new platform or upgrading a RAC cluster from an older version of Oracle to the current version of Oracle, the following references will be helpful:

References for running RAC with Applications

RAC and Oracle E-Business

  • Document 362135.1 Configuring Oracle Applications Release 11i with Oracle10g Release 2 Real Application Clusters and Automatic Storage Management.
  • Document 380489.1 Using Load-Balancers with Oracle E-Business Suite Release 12 
  • Document 727171.1 Implementing Load Balancing On Oracle E-Business Suite - Documentation For Specific Load Balancer Hardware 
  • Document 217368.1 Advanced Configurations and Topologies for Enterprise Deployments of E-Business Suite 11i 
  • Document 403347.1 MAA Roadmap for the E-Business Suite 
  • Document 388577.1 Using Oracle 10gR2 RAC and Automatic Storage Management with Oracle E-Business Suite Release 12

RAC ASM Documentation

Automatic Storage Management (ASM) is an evolution in file system and volume management functionality for Oracle database files. ASM further enhances automation and simplicity in storage management that is critical to the success of the Oracle grid architecture. ASM also improves file system scalability and performance, manageability and database availability for RAC environments. Use of ASM with RAC is an Oracle Best Practice.

 

MAA/Standby Documentation

Data Guard provides the management, monitoring, and automation software infrastructure to create and maintain one or more standby databases to protect Oracle data from failures, disasters, errors, and data corruptions. As users commit transactions at a primary database, Oracle generates redo records and writes them to a local online log file.

 

Using My Oracle Support Effectively

REFERENCES

NOTE:1054902.1  - How to Validate Network and Name Resolution Setup for the Clusterware and RAC
NOTE:747457.1  - How to Convert 10g Single-Instance database to 10g RAC using Manual Conversion procedure
NOTE:754594.1  - Potential disk corruption when adding a node to a cluster
NOTE:756671.1  - Oracle Recommended Patches -- Oracle Database
NOTE:283684.1  - How to Modify Private Network Information in Oracle Clusterware
NOTE:438314.1  - Critical Patch Update - Introduction to Database n-Apply CPUs
NOTE:850471.1  - Oracle Announces First Patch Set Update For Oracle Database Release 10.2
NOTE:854428.1  - Patch Set Updates for Oracle Products
NOTE:811293.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(AIX)
NOTE:169706.1  - Oracle Database (RDBMS) on Unix AIX,HP-UX,Linux,Mac OS X,Solaris,Tru64 Unix Operating Systems Installation and Configuration Requirements Quick Reference (8.0.5 to 11.2)
NOTE:742060.1  - Release Schedule of Current Database Releases
NOTE:745960.1  - 11g How to Unpack a Package in to ADR
NOTE:289690.1  - Data Collecting for Troubleshooting Oracle Clusterware (CRS or GI) And Real Application Cluster (RAC) Issues
NOTE:811271.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(Windows)
NOTE:301137.1  - OSWatcher Black Box (Includes: [Video])
NOTE:359515.1  - Mount Options for Oracle files when used with NFS on NAS devices
NOTE:361323.1  - HugePages on Linux: What It Is... and What It Is Not...
NOTE:761111.1  - RDBMS Online Patching Aka Hot Patching
NOTE:454507.1  - ALERT: Oracle 11g Release 1 (11.1) Support Status and Alerts
NOTE:459694.1  - Procwatcher: Script to Monitor and Examine Oracle DB and Clusterware Processes
NOTE:466181.1  - Oracle 10g Upgrade Companion
NOTE:557204.1  - Oracle Clusterware CRSD OCSSD EVMD Log Rotation Policy
NOTE:265769.1  - Troubleshooting 10g and 11.1 Clusterware Reboots
NOTE:184875.1  - How To Check The Certification Matrix for Real Application Clusters
NOTE:276434.1  - How to Modify Public Network Information including VIP in Oracle Clusterware
NOTE:811303.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(HP-UX)
NOTE:759565.1  - Oracle NUMA Usage Recommendation
NOTE:280939.1  - Checklist for Performance Problems with Parallel Execution
NOTE:811306.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(Linux)
NOTE:220970.1  - RAC: Frequently Asked Questions
NOTE:209768.1  - Database, FMW, EM Grid Control, and OCS Software Error Correction Support Policy
NOTE:726446.1  - What Is The Difference Between RDA and Oracle Configuration Manager?
NOTE:727171.1  - Implementing Load Balancing On Oracle E-Business Suite - Documentation For Specific Load Balancer Hardware
NOTE:736752.1  - Introducing Cluster Health Monitor (IPD/OS)
NOTE:1101938.1  - Master Note for Data Guard
NOTE:1082394.1  - 11.2.0.1.X Grid Infrastructure PSU Known Issues
NOTE:868955.1  - Get Proactive - Oracle Health Checks - Installation, troubleshooting, catalog and more.
NOTE:887522.1  - Grid Infrastructure Single Client Access Name (SCAN) Explained
NOTE:92602.1  - pre-10gR1: How to Password Protect the Listener
NOTE:948456.1  - Pre 11.2 Database Issues in 11gR2 Grid Infrastructure Environment
NOTE:1050693.1  - Troubleshooting 11.2 Clusterware Node Evictions (Reboots)
NOTE:1050908.1  - Troubleshoot Grid Infrastructure Startup Issues
NOTE:363254.1  - Applying one-off Oracle Clusterware patches in a mixed version home environment
NOTE:380489.1  - Using Load-Balancers with Oracle E-Business Suite Release 12
NOTE:395314.1  - RAC Hangs due to small cache size on SYS.AUDSES$
NOTE:397460.1  - Oracle's Policy for Supporting Oracle RAC with Symantec SFRAC
NOTE:388577.1  - Using Oracle 10g Release 2 Real Application Clusters and Automatic Storage Management with Oracle E-Business Suite Release 12
NOTE:390374.1  - Oracle Performance Diagnostic Guide (OPDG)
NOTE:391771.1  - OCFS2 1.2 - FREQUENTLY ASKED QUESTIONS
NOTE:401132.1  - How to Install Oracle Clusterware with Shared Storage on Block Devices
NOTE:403347.1  - MAA Roadmap for the E-Business Suite
NOTE:785351.1  - Oracle 11gR2 Upgrade Companion
NOTE:787420.1  - Cluster Interconnect in Oracle 10g and 11gR1 RAC
NOTE:790189.1  - Oracle Clusterware and Application Failover Management
NOTE:810394.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(Platform Independent)
NOTE:783456.1  - CRS Diagnostic Data Gathering: A Summary of Common tools and their Usage
NOTE:428681.1  - OCR / Vote disk Maintenance Operations: (ADD/REMOVE/REPLACE/MOVE)
NOTE:810663.1  - 11.1.0.X CRS Bundle Patch Information

NOTE:559365.1  - Using Diagwait as a diagnostic to get more information for diagnosing Oracle Clusterware Node evictions
NOTE:811151.1  - How to Install Oracle Cluster Health Monitor (former IPD/OS) on Windows
NOTE:429825.1  - Complete Checklist for Manual Upgrades to 11gR1
NOTE:77483.1  - External Support FTP site: Information Sheet
NOTE:1268927.1  - RACcheck - RAC Configuration Audit Tool
NOTE:563566.1  - Troubleshooting gc block lost and Poor Network Performance in a RAC Environment
NOTE:563905.1  - Implementing LIBUMEM for CRS on Solaris 64
NOTE:601807.1  - Oracle 11gR1 Upgrade Companion
NOTE:316817.1  - Cluster Verification Utility (CLUVFY) FAQ
NOTE:316900.1  - ALERT: Oracle 10g Release 2 (10.2) Support Status and Alerts
NOTE:330358.1  - CRS 10gR2/ 11gR1/ 11gR2 Diagnostic Collection Guide
NOTE:337737.1  - Oracle Clusterware - ASM - Database Version Compatibility
NOTE:338706.1  - Oracle Clusterware (CRS or GI) Rolling Upgrades
NOTE:1187674.1  - Master Note for Oracle Database Machine and Exadata Storage Server
NOTE:1187723.1  - Master Note for Automatic Storage Management (ASM)
NOTE:403743.1  - Pre-11.2: VIP Failover Take Long Time After Network Cable Pulled
NOTE:332257.1  - Using Oracle Clusterware with Vendor Clusterware FAQ
NOTE:1065024.1  - Database 11g Release 2 Certification Highlights
NOTE:181489.1  - Tuning Inter-Instance Performance in RAC and OPS
NOTE:405820.1  - 10.2.0.X CRS Bundle Patch Information
NOTE:422893.1  - 11g Understanding Automatic Diagnostic Repository.
NOTE:1328466.1  - Cluster Health Monitor (CHM) FAQ
NOTE:443529.1  - Database 11g: Quick Steps to Package and Send Critical Error Diagnostic Information to Support [Video]
NOTE:357472.1  - Configuring device-mapper for CRS/ASM
NOTE:362135.1  - Configuring Oracle Applications Release 11i with Oracle10g Release 2 Real Application Clusters and Automatic Storage Management
NOTE:217368.1  - Advanced Configurations and Topologies for Enterprise Deployments of E-Business Suite 11i
NOTE:219361.1  - Troubleshooting ORA-29740 in a RAC Environment
NOTE:1367153.1  - Top 5 Issues That Cause Node Reboots or Evictions or Unexpected Recycle of CRS
NOTE:166650.1  - Working Effectively With Support Best Practices
NOTE:1053147.1  - 11gR2 Clusterware and Grid Home - What You Need to Know
NOTE:1452965.2  - Information Center: Oracle Scalability Grid Infrastructure / Clusterware and Real Application Clusters (RAC)
NOTE:811280.1  - RAC and Oracle Clusterware Best Practices and Starter Kit (Solaris)
NOTE:314422.1  - Remote Diagnostic Agent (RDA) - Getting Started
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值